Nice job on finishing a design brief!👌 Addressing user concerns with empathy and providing next steps in your copy was great.
Some improvements you can look into:
- Conciseness: Notifications must be brief due to character limits. Aim for succinct messages that convey essential information swiftly.
- Brand Voice: The notification's brand voice wasn't clear. Don’t be scared to get creative and inject distinctive voice, this will help enhance brand recognition and user connection.
- Effectiveness: An explanation of the notification strategy was missing did it maybe not attach? This would offer insight into your design decisions on this brief.
- Variety: It seems only one notification was provided. Including a full set for review would showcase range and strategy.
